Output 7659dc4fe2043718ca9f5d68e1f9d028953bbf70ea56fa8602ee96abbe1e4111:8

value
15898
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18ebc4cf5510625f5de5fd3cfb86e0cd7e40a1c4021620fb49f33e7e5c596824
address
bc1prr4ufn64zp397h09l570hphqe4lypgwyqgtzp76f7vl8uhzedqjqz9m9gw
transaction
7659dc4fe2043718ca9f5d68e1f9d028953bbf70ea56fa8602ee96abbe1e4111
spent
true